Transaction 3cc23f7ce332dbf072efef324adc56755148a85d1048f2a4a32cd181b42d5923

1 Input
2 Outputs
  • 3cc23f7ce332dbf072efef324adc56755148a85d1048f2a4a32cd181b42d5923:0
  • value  32666127
    address  369YfDKXaqfbXHS5B1spwzuzK89DF2p2ws
  • 3cc23f7ce332dbf072efef324adc56755148a85d1048f2a4a32cd181b42d5923:1
  • value  160095776
    address  1C9jhDbjj9PXRfgywXjYhwT4tC9tGcDKXJ